A Talala woman has been arrested for leaving her 1-year-old child in a hot vehicle for nearly an hour on Owasso.

The 38-year-old woman was arrested Tuesday evening after Owasso police say pedestrians saw her child in a parked car outside a Wal-Mart Supercenter. A police report says the child was left alone for about 45 minutes in a car that reached internal temperatures of 120 to 138 degrees.

The child was transported to St. John Medical Center in Owasso for treatment, and was released into the custody of the child's father.

According to the report, the suspect told officers she forgot the child was in the car when she went into the store.

The woman is being held in lieu of $50,000 bond on child abuse complaint.​

A couple says they were leaving Walmart when they heard a noise in the distance.

“We walked past the van and it didn’t quite sit right with me,” said Chrysty Lansdowne. “I just said to Jay, ‘What was that sound?”

The couple told KJRH they could barely hear the baby calling out for help.

“You imagine the baby is crying in the car because it is so hot. She wasn’t crying at all,” said Lansdowne.

The couple looked through the tinted windows of the van and spotted the child.

“If the baby would have been unconscious or asleep, we would have had no idea,” said Jedidiah Bizzell.

The couple says the baby was covered in sweat and looked exhausted.

They told KJRH they frantically pulled all the door handles until they could get one open.

After getting the child out of the car, they called 911.

Paramedics say the child’s internal temperature was more than 100 degrees, so they took her to an area hospital.

According to the police report, a responding firefighter told officers the temperature inside the car would have reached 120 to 138 degrees within 10 minutes of the door being closed.

Police stopped the child’s mother, Hannah Secondi, as she left the store.

They say she “began frantically asking if her child was deceased.”

(...)

However, Landsdowne says Secondi left the store with another child and doesn’t believe the 1-year-old was simply forgotten.

“It is not like, ‘Oh, I just ran inside real quick, I completely forgot, the day was crazy,’and she was alone,” she said. “There was [sic] more people with her. There is no reason why the baby should have been left in the car. Not at all.”

Secondi was arrested for child abuse.​

A woman who left her child alone in a hot car at the Owasso WalMart a couple of years ago is in trouble again.

The Tulsa County DA wants a judge to revoke Hannah Secondi's two-year deferred sentence for that crime and send her to prison.

When Secondi pleaded guilty to child neglect, she agreed to stay out of trouble for two years, but the prosecutor said Secondi has violated that agreement and should serve her sentence behind bars.

They said one violation is a report from Rogers County of Secondi's toddler daughter wandering away from home wearing nothing but a diaper.

Secondi pleaded guilty six months later and because it was her first offense, she got a two-year deferred sentence, which means no jail time as long as she didn't violate her rules or get into trouble again.

But, six months after that, Rogers County deputies got a call of a child wandering around a field, covered in scratches, wearing nothing but a diaper. A neighbor took her in until deputies arrived.

Deputies said when they first talked to Secondi, she wasn't honest about her daughter being missing.

The Rogers County DA did not file charges because the case was referred to DHS.

The prosecutor on the Tulsa County case said it doesn't matter that charges weren't filed, the fact a report was filed of Secondi once again failing to supervise her children, is enough to ask a judge to revoke Secondi's previous sentence.
